After my ebike got stolen over the labor day weekend, I've decided to go back to my roots of beach cruisers and purchased a Priority Coast 7 speed. I like this bike because of the belt drive and internal gear hub making it a low maintenance bike. In the past, I have owned Electra Townies and sixthreezero EvryJourney.

I just got a Priority Coast too. Mines a three speed, matte olive as well. As a geezer at 73 I have to say this is the smoothest, quietest bike I have ever ridden. I've retired my Giant 7 speed cruiser. I thought I'd build it into something interesting but now I doubt I'd ever ride it again. This belt drive is that good.
